  • NPTC Safe use of Pesticides PA1 & PA6


    Unit PA1 is the mandatory foundation unit covering the relevant legislation. The unit PA6 involves the practical safe application via a knapsack applicator with a hydraulic nozzle or rotary atomiser-type sprayers.

  • NPTC CS30 Chainsaw Course

    This qualification is about the maintenance of a chainsaw and cross-cutting trees at ground level. Chainsaws used in aerial and ground work are covered. This work will be carried out in a workshop or a woodland environment.
